A good boiler installation company will be able to provide you with impartial advice on which type of boiler is best for you. However, you should already have decided which type of fuel you want the appliance to run on before looking at boiler installers in Manchester.

For most people this will be a very simple choice, as the majority of households use a gas central heating system, but nearly five million homes are not connected to the gas mains and do not have this option. If your property is not connected to the gas network, you have three main alternatives. This might be a boiler which uses liquid petroleum gas (LPG), an oil boiler or, if your primary source of heating is a wood burner, you can also have a stove fitted with a back boiler.

Types Of Boiler

The majority of homes with older heating systems have a heat only boiler, which is designed exclusively to provide warmth for the home. However, most people who are having a new boiler installed now opt for a combi-boiler.

A combi-boiler will both heat your radiators and your hot water. It can be more energy efficient and more convenient, since it heats hot water on demand. Many homeowners also prefer it because it allows you to remove the hot water tank, which frees up the space for other purposes.

This type of system is not right for all households, however. You can only use the heated water for one task at a time, so if somebody turns on a kitchen tap while the shower is running, the shower will run cold. This means that larger households with more simultaneous activities going on may struggle with a combi-boiler. Your installation professional will be able to give you more advice about whether a combination model or heat-only appliance is best for you.

Brands And Efficiency Ratings

All boilers will come with information about their energy efficiency. A higher rating means that your carbon footprint will be smaller, which is considered better for the environment. But there are cost saving benefits too.

The more efficient your boiler is, the lower your bills will be. Therefore, it can be worth checking out consumer tests to see which brands have the best ratings. If you have a preference on brands, make sure that your chosen installer is certified to fit your preffered boiler and that they are able to supply any necessary parts.
